Transaction af2820cc0718063498c8b325bd9f1c9d993efc6f76e80db70224d57f1cf72ab4
1 Input
2 Outputs
- af2820cc0718063498c8b325bd9f1c9d993efc6f76e80db70224d57f1cf72ab4:0
- af2820cc0718063498c8b325bd9f1c9d993efc6f76e80db70224d57f1cf72ab4:1
value 691660
address 3FCQ7FSuWwFHjiXpXpp79KqbmBLBqkVRua
value 14392747
address 1BrfHz4KNtFc1dRXypxJWatz31cUZuxABy